1) Max for Live

2) Max for Live

3) Collaboration with others who use Max for Live


The new formats since 8.1 can not be loaded with earlier versions though. And 8.1 is needed for Max for Live. Hence the reasons. If none of these pertain to you and your system is running smooth, you don't really need to update.
